Dating back to the dawn of bloggy man, 2002, Blogcritics.org has been not only a place to read great individual reviews, essays, interviews, and news stories, but also a place that accurately reflects the mind of the greater blogosphere. As a voluntary collective of self-motivated writers, WHAT, HOW, and with what INTENSITY BC writers choose to cover a given film, TV show, album, or world event is a revealing synecdoche of the blogging whole. In addition to gathering together in one convenient spot all of our coverage on enveloping topics such as Michael Jackson’s untimely death or the ’08 Presidential election, Blogcritics Features are also ongoing columns on such topics as new album, book, and iPhone app releases, movie box office reports, TV show coverage, or live theater reviews, to name but a few.
